What a Respiratory, Developmental, Rehabilitative and Restorative Service Providers - Pediatric Occupational Therapist provider does

Pediatric providers specialize in the health and medical care of infants, children, and adolescents. They monitor growth and development, administer vaccinations, and treat acute and chronic childhood illnesses.

Common conditions treated

Common conditions include ear infections, strep throat, RSV and other respiratory viruses, asthma, eczema, ADHD, childhood obesity, and behavioral concerns. Pediatric providers also treat minor injuries and provide developmental screenings.

Common reasons to schedule a visit

Common reasons for pediatric visits include well-child checkups, vaccinations, developmental assessments, treatment of common childhood illnesses, and behavioral or school-related concerns.

What to expect during a visit

Well-child visits track growth, milestones, and immunizations on a recommended schedule. Bring questions about feeding, sleep, behavior, or development to each appointment.
